Florida Lawmakers Advance DeSantis' Property Tax Reduction Proposal to Ballot
2 Haziran 2026Bloomberg
- Florida lawmakers have moved forward with a modified proposal from Governor Ron DeSantis aimed at reducing property taxes. The revised plan excludes local school districts, which has raised concerns among some stakeholders.
- This decision will now be presented to voters on the ballot. The changes reflect ongoing debates about tax reform and funding for education in the state.
- The property tax reform initiative is part of a broader agenda by Governor DeSantis to address cost-of-living issues in Florida. The decision to exclude school districts reflects a compromise aimed at simplifying the proposal, but it also highlights the tension between tax relief and educational investment.
- The exclusion of local school districts from the property tax reduction plan could have significant implications for education funding in Florida. While the intent to lower taxes may appeal to voters, it raises questions about the sustainability of school budgets and the quality of education.
